    a low mileage 458 is £150k here, a low mileage 458 spec is £350k here
    a low mileage 458 spider is £160k , an aperta £740k

    it's all about rarity I think and people will hold on to the 296 special editions on the presumption that they are going to be worth over double the standard cars as we've already seen happen with the 458
